Easier way to connect vacuum line under intake?
There is a vacuum line that goes under the intercooler to intake pipe that is essentially on the intake, and it is rediculously difficult to get a vacuum line onto it.

This is the one under the throttle body at the front, right? Hook everything else up, sit the intake in place but don't bolt it down yet. Lift slightly, hook up the vacuum line and then re-seat the intake and bolt everything down. It's not that hard. The hardest thing is that infernal 10mm bolt holding the oil dipstick in place.
